RPT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

165 of the 4,878 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in RPT Realty Common Shares of Beneficial Interest (MD) (RPT)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$540M — up 8.7% from $497M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 25 funds opened new RPT positions and 20 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 60 added to existing stakes and 56 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$4.68M. The largest seller was Westwood Holdings Group, cutting an estimated $8.92M.
